* Silver's [[rival]] is Ethan, as his team in the flashback is based on if the player chooses {{p|Cyndaquil}} as their {{pkmn2|starter}}, which Ethan has.

* All versions of Silver use special voice-over lines upon entering a team that contains certain Trainers (regardless of their partner Pokémon) and victory with them. Those Trainers include {{mas|Giovanni}}, {{mas|Lance}}, {{mas|Ethan}}, {{mas|Lyra}}, and {{mas|N}}.

* In [[Sygna Suit]] Silver's sync pair story, it is implied that Silver stole Sneasel from its original Trainer. Although it was never stated in the [[core series]] games, Silver is shown with a Sneasel after Kirk{{tt|*|Known as Mania in Generation II}} from [[Cianwood City]] says that Silver bullied him into giving up an unnamed Pokémon. This could imply that the unnamed Pokémon that Silver stole was indeed Sneasel.
